Again, the point of voltage control is at the grid entry point which causes technical difficulty for co-located battery energy storage systems with existing generation plants. The necessity to control voltage at the grid entry point could lead to two individual control systems, the BESS and the existing plant, operating on the same busbar.
Battery storage co-located with a wind farm can compensate for the stochastic behaviour of wind power by smoothing short-term fluctuations [14] and by time-shifting the otherwise curtailed wind energy to higher price selling periods, thus storing surplus and also increasing the revenue of the wind farm [17], [18].

The diagram below illustrates the cycle of energy production and release to the grid of a co-located solar and battery site 1. 1. BESS (Battery Energy Storage System) dispatches to the grid when energy prices are high, before solar generation is possible (i.e. before dawn). 2. Solar dispatches to the grid during daylight hours.
